This is a senior role for an experienced transportation professional who can lead complex assignments, manage key client relationships, provide technical oversight, mentor staff, and support growth across our Ontario transportation portfolio.
The successful candidate will bring strong project delivery experience across provincial, municipal, regional, and transit-sector clients. This role is intended to strengthen senior delivery capacity, improve technical and quality oversight, support strategic pursuits, and help develop the next generation of transportation leaders within the Toronto team.
The successful candidate must be able to support GFT’s positioning on transportation pursuits and be eligible to serve as senior/key personnel for relevant MTO RAQS categories.
You will provide senior project management, technical leadership, and client-facing support for transportation infrastructure projects across Ontario. Assignments may include highway and roadway planning/design, traffic engineering, corridor improvements, municipal roads, transit-supportive infrastructure, transportation operations, safety reviews, construction staging, detour planning, and multidisciplinary infrastructure programs.
You will also play a key role in strengthening the Toronto Transportation Practice by supporting proposal development, mentoring junior and intermediate staff, improving delivery consistency, and helping the team win and deliver high-quality work.
